Ive just returned from the Sol Pelicanos Ocas. I will firstly describe a few bad points.
1. Queuing for sunbeds - horrendous!
2. Queuing sometimes for dinner and breakfast
3. not always easy to find a clean table and some of restaurant staff weren't willing to help! Seemed understaffed sometimes
4. one night in height of season NO adult entertainment!!! That night it's a bouncy castle thing for the kids and my daughter said it was awful - queuing with my granddaughter for ages and then only seconds on it!!
5. If you go for more than a week you get the same shows! Quality of shows was Okish but all taped music - nothing live!
6. We received a shocking "welcome." There was a mix up with the booking as we'd added someone on late and this caused the problem. Alberto the receptionist handled it in an abrupt, unfriendly and rather unpleasant manner. His female colleague at least smiled at us and tried! We have no idea whether it was the hotel's fault or On The Beach's fault - but the point is it was handed TERRIBLY causing some distress as this was a massively important holiday for the 10 of us as our son was arriving later from Hong Kong and we hadn't seen him for 18 months!!!!!!!!!! My paperwork was all in order clearly stating the change and it took them ages to allocate the rooms and I honestly thought the holiday was going to be a complete disaster. I felt sorry for the people queuing behind us as it took so long!
A smile and a "Im so sorry about this" would have been so easy!!!!!
It was handled TERRIBLY.
Good reception staff is absolutely imperative!
7. Complete lack of enough chairs for evening show - one night dozens had to stand! Outrageous!!
8. Not enough sunbeds
GOOD POINTS
1. Fabulous food - I'm at a loss as to how anyone could grumble about it!
2. Excellent all inclusive drinks - don't go half board unless you dont drink!
3. The most wonderful huge lagoon pool which made the holiday. Lovely jakuzzis in pool. Other pools too. Very good daytime entertainment. Lovely entertainment staff. Lovely staff in pool bar. Lovely staff in all the bars who smiled and were friendly despite working hard.
4. Lovely clean bedroom. Great balcony.
5. I had a fall and lifeguard and manager were lovely and caring and attentive
6. Near to beach and in good location
7. I WOULD return but definitely not in the height of the season as I cant BEAR queues on holiday.

The superior and family rooms are renovated so they are quite correct, the buffet is very varied and in general quite good, the only downside is the dinner schedule that closes at 9:30 p.m. The very attentive and friendly entertainment (highlight the opening hours of the shows at 10 o'clock at night !!! very good so that the Spaniards give us time to see it) and the hotel staff also very pleasant and efficient.
Highlight the large pool lake that is wonderful ... let's repeat!

Benidorm Hotel 3 stars. Good customer service. 400 meters away From the Levante beach. Good pools one of them simulating an artificial lake. With 3 yacuzis. Also pool bar. A good place to rest or spend the holidays. The buffets are very good.
